How Online Food Delivery Is Changing the Way We Eat

Food ordering online has grown from the convenience of present-day life into a force that is changing the way we think and deal with food. This transformation entails that, at the touch of a few buttons, we can have a variety of cuisines delivered to our homes or offices. This is not just all about convenience; it entails changes in technology, people’s preferences, and lifestyle affecting the way we dine. Let’s take a deeper look at how online food delivery is changing the way we eat.

1. Convenience at Our Fingertips

Undeniably, one of the most evident ways in which online food delivery has changed our eating habits is with unmatched convenience. With tight schedules and scurrying lifestyles, many find it difficult to cook a meal from scratch each day. Online food delivery services made access to meals much easier without having to leave the comfort of one’s home. Be it a quick lunch during busy working days, or a midnight craving; today, we can place an order with any kind of restaurant serving any kind of cuisine, just by tapping on our smartphones a couple of times.

2. Widening Gourmet Perspectives

Food delivery through online services has widely expanded our culinary horizons. Earlier, we could only think of trying restaurants within the local precincts of our residence. Online food platforms today can access more restaurants and varieties of cuisines from different parts of the world than ever before. This means we can indulge in authentic Thai curries, Italian pastas, or Japanese sushi without necessarily leaving our neighborhood. And diversity has been a facilitator, helping us become more familiar with trying new flavors and dishes we may never have tried otherwise.

3. Healthier Eating Options

More health awareness has led to upgraded food delivery services, making their service healthier. Most websites will have the nutrition facts of each item on their menu. Whether low-calorie, low-carb, or gluten-free, one will surely find a healthy meal option that best suits the individual’s dietary needs. Moreover, several services collaborate with nutrition experts to offer customized meal plans for each client. This makes reaching health objectives that much easier for customers.

4. Customization and Personalization

Online food delivery sites boast of really advanced features for customization, keeping in mind individual tastes and preferences. You could get dishes altered according to your taste-whether it is less spice, substitute items, or portion size. Such personalization would make sure that every meal is just exactly as you want it, thus improving dining so much. Moreover, AI-enabled algorithms will study your ordering history and preference lists for meal recommendations that you might want, and finding your next favorite meal is rather easy.

5. Boosting of Local Economies

Online food delivery is not only about convenience, but it also does a lot of good to the local economies. Partnering with local restaurants and small businesses, such platforms give more visibility to and enhance revenues generated by local eateries. This becomes even more relevant for independent restaurants that might find the going very hard to reach out to a larger audience without this model of online delivery. Also, most of the services now focus on sourcing ingredients locally, which further helps contribute to the local economy and reduces the environmental impact.

6. Dining Habits: Changes Brave

Online food ordering changes traditional meal behaviors. Since one can get food at any time, following the routine times of meals becomes less likely. Conducive to this flexibility, one can easily get more spontaneous in eating-for instance, ordering breakfast at noon, or even dinner at midnight. This ease with which food can be ordered online has increased the variety of takeout meals ordered, varying how one conventionally would plan and prepare a day’s food.

7. Going Green

Sustainability is a growing concern in the food delivery online service sector. Many of them offer green options by changing packaging to recyclable or compostable and decreasing plastic waste. Some platforms pledge themselves to apply a policy of ethical and sustainable food sourcing. All that trend corresponds to the modern customer’s growing demand for eco-friendly options and contributes to decreasing the ecological footprint of ordered food.

8. The Future of Dining

And, with technology at neck-breaking speed, the future of food delivery is going to be quite interesting. Innovations such as drone delivery and autonomous vehicles are in the works, which could definitely change the way we get our meals in the years to come. Even virtual kitchens or “ghost kitchens”-places where restaurants cook exclusively for delivery-are emerging, allowing restaurants greater freedom to experiment with their menus, while granting them faster service.

Conclusion

From unparalleled convenience to expanding our palates and even to healthier eating, online food delivery is changing the way we eat in more and more ways. And as that change continues, expect even more innovations in the future that keep redefining dining. Whether it’s a quick meal, exploring cuisines, or healthy eating, online food delivery makes it easier than ever to have the foods you love.
